Types of Insurance plan Designs

Family members often encounter several different coverage ideas, like Employer-Sponsored Insurance policies, Medicaid, and private insurance policy. Each and every comes along with its individual coverage specs and constraints. It is important for family members to meticulously go around their insurance plan coverage to comprehend the details of protection related to ABA therapy, together with:

Coverage limitations: Some programs may Restrict the amount of therapy several hours or sessions per year.

Pre-approval necessities: Certain insurers may well demand pre-acceptance right before therapy commences, which requires distributing detailed documentation of the necessity for products and services.

In-community compared to out-of-network vendors: People must examine whether their preferred ABA therapy vendors are lined below their insurance plan program to reduce out-of-pocket bills.

Navigating the Insurance Statements Process

The claims system can be challenging for family members navigating insurance policies protection for ABA therapy. Here are several tactics that can help streamline the process:

Documentation: Obtain in depth documentation to aid the healthcare requirement of ABA therapy. This might include evaluations, therapy options, and letters from qualified gurus.

Post Promises Immediately: Make certain that insurance coverage promises are submitted immediately to prevent delays in acceptance.

Comply with-Up: Abide by up Along with the insurance policies service provider often to examine claims status and address any challenges.

Know Your Rights: Familiarize by yourself With all the appeals process if a declare is denied. Insurers are lawfully obligated to provide a method for policyholders to enchantment selections.

Find Assistance: Think about enlisting the help of advocates or businesses specializing in insurance policy navigation to assist during the promises procedure.
